The  full unsealed indictment of FPOTUS Donald J. Trump that was filed in the SDC of  Florida -  containing 38 counts under the Espionage Act:

https://storage.courtlistener.com/recap/gov.uscourts.flsd.648653/gov.uscourts.flsd.648653.3.0.pdf

The first judge listed on the docket as attending to the indictment next Tuesday is Judge Aileen Cannon - the same Trump appointed Article III judge who controversially obstructed the DOJ last year by enjoining the entire Federal investigation, before the appellate courts unanimously overturned all her rulings

This judge is now apparently preparing to hear appeals for a summary dismissal of all charges by Trump's new lawyers - (the old ones just walked).

This could get interesting very fast indeed.

He's got  a busy 2024 in court. Politico:

Quote

NEW YORK — Donald Trump’s trial calendar is starting to fill up.

On Thursday, a federal judge set a trial date of Jan. 15, 2024, in a defamation lawsuit brought against the former president by writer E. Jean Carroll. It will be sandwiched between two other Trump trials: a civil trial scheduled for this October in a fraud lawsuit against Trump and his company brought by the New York attorney general, and a criminal trial set for late March 2024 on charges that Trump falsified business records in connection with hush money payments to a porn star.
